pLysE vector (V010928)

Basic Vector Information

Vector Name:
pLysE
Antibiotic Resistance:
Chloramphenicol
Length:
4886 bp
Type:
pET & Duet Vectors (Novagen)
Replication origin:
p15A ori
Source/Author:
Novagen (EMD Millipore)
Copy Number:
Medium copy number

Plasmid Resuspension Protocol:

1. Centrifuge at 5,000×g for 5 min.

2. Carefully open the tube and add 20 μl of sterile water to dissolve the DNA.

3. Close the tube and incubate for 10 minutes at room temperature.

4. Briefly vortex the tube and then do a quick spin to concentrate the liquid at the bottom. Speed is less than 5000×g.

5.Store the plasmid at -20 ℃.
